Gaming controllers have undergone a remarkable evolution since the early days of video gaming. Initially, controllers were simplistic, often consisting of a few buttons and a joystick, designed for systems like the Atari 2600 in the late 1970s. As technology progressed, controllers became more elaborate, incorporating features such as ergonomic designs, additional buttons, and even vibration feedback. The introduction of the analog stick by Sony with the PlayStation was a significant turning point, allowing for greater precision and control in gameplay. As the years rolled on, we saw the rise of wireless technology and customizable settings, providing gamers with a more personalized and immersive experience.
With the shift from traditional consoles to PC gaming, the demand for versatile controllers grew immensely. While consoles typically have standardized controllers, the PC gaming landscape is more eclectic, accommodating a variety of input devices from traditional gamepads to mechanical keyboards and gaming mice. This broad spectrum not only allows players to choose based on comfort but also enhances their gameplay experience, catering to different genres and styles. In this ever-evolving market, innovations such as programmable buttons and integration with virtual reality are shaping the future of gaming control systems, ensuring that both console and PC gamers will benefit from ongoing advancements in technology.
When it comes to enhancing your gaming experience on PC, choosing the right controller is crucial. The top 5 controllers that seamlessly integrate with PC gaming provide not only comfort but also exceptional performance. First on our list is the Xbox Elite Wireless Controller Series 2. This controller features customizable buttons and adjustable tension thumbsticks, allowing players to tailor their gameplay experience. Its compatibility with Windows PCs makes it a favorite among gamers looking for versatility.
Another excellent option is the PlayStation DualSense Wireless Controller, renowned for its innovative haptic feedback and adaptive triggers that heighten immersion in games. Following closely is the Razer Wolverine Ultimate, which boasts a rugged design and customizable RGB lighting, ensuring it stands out in both performance and aesthetics. Finally, for those on a budget, the Logitech F310 Gamepad offers a solid performance without breaking the bank, proving that great gaming experiences can come at an affordable price.
If you're an avid PC gamer, you might be surprised to learn that switching from a keyboard to a controller can enhance your gaming experience significantly. Controllers offer a level of comfort and ergonomics that can reduce fatigue during long gaming sessions. Their intuitive layout allows for fluid motion, giving you more control over your character's actions. For instance, you'll find that navigating complex environments becomes easier when your fingers can rest comfortably on the joystick, providing quick access to essential functions without the need to stretch your fingers across a keyboard.
Moreover, many modern PC games are optimized for controllers, making the gameplay smoother and more responsive. You can achieve precise movements and accuracy with the analog sticks that are often difficult to replicate with a keyboard. Features such as vibration feedback can also immerse you deeper into the gameplay experience, enhancing your emotional connection with the game. In essence, making the switch to a controller could elevate your gaming performance and allow you to fully enjoy the richness of your favorite PC titles.
